Côte Saint-Luc residents can now register online for recreation programs

Côte Saint-Luc, November 27, 2009 – Côte Saint-Luc residents will now have the opportunity to register for programs and reserve the city’s facilities online at CoteSaintLuc.org.

Beginning November 30 at 6:30pm, Côte Saint-Luc residents will be able to sign into their account and register for Parks and Recreation Department programs online for the winter session. Starting December 1, residents will also be able to check the availability of various recreational facilities, which will enable them to complete an online facility rental request.

“With online registration, residents will now be able to view, register and pay for recreation department programs from the comfort of their own home,” Mayor Anthony Housefather said. “This is part of a city-wide effort to develop online tools to make it easier to interact with the city government.”

If someone in your household has registered for a program in the past two years, call the Parks and Recreation Department to receive your username and password. If no one in your household has signed up for a program in the last two years, visit CoteSaintLuc.org to create an account for all members of your family.

“Online registration will provide our residents with another convenient way to register for our city programs,” said Councillor Mitchell Brownstein, the council member responsible for parks and recreation issues. “Of course, residents can still register at the Parks and Recreation Department Building.”
